BOSTON — Albert Ernest Russell Jr., 68, of Jolin Street, Lewiston, died Friday, July 13, at Mass General Hospital, with his family by his side.

He was born in Lewiston, March 18, 1944, a son of the late Albert E. and Clara Crabtree Russell Sr. He was educated in Lewiston schools. Al served in the U.S. Air Force and U.S. Army during the Vietnam Conflict, retiring after 22 years of service. He then worked at Pioneer Plastic as a pipefitter. He enjoyed spending time with his children and grandchildren.

He is survived by his wife, the former Monique St. Hilaire (Houle) of Lewiston; a daughter, Dawn Nacri and husband, Angelo, of Lewiston; two sons, Albert Russell III and his companion, Kathy White, of Lewiston and Ryan Russell of Sabattus; three stepchildren, Matt and Paula Nason of Turner, Scott and Jenny Adams of Lewiston and Aaron and Corina Wright of Sabattus; 13 grandchildren; a great-granddaughter; two sisters, Larry Barbara Straffin and Willis Hilda Davis; and a brother, David and wife, Patty Russell.

He was predeceased by a brother, Warren Russell; and his wife, the former Evelyn Turcotte.
